WebApr 9, 2024 · The horseshoe is one of the most well-known good luck symbols of the Western world. Some believe that a horseshoe with the two ends pointing up collects good luck and keeps it from falling out. Witches were believed to fear horses, so hanging a horseshoe warded them off. WebJul 20, 2024 · Claddagh rings are a 400-year-old Irish tradition that depict two hands holding a heart topped by a crown.
